Verition Fund Management's TSCO Position: Q1 2026 in Review

Verition Fund Management sold out of Tractor Supply (TSCO) in Q1 2026, closing a stake of 160,299 shares — an estimated $8.17M sold.

Verition Fund Management first reported a position in TSCO in Q2 2014 and held it in 31 quarters. The position peaked at $16.9M in Q1 2024. 1,160 funds tracked by Wall St. Rank hold TSCO as of Q1 2026.
